.cc-import-calculator{--cc-blue: #0D53BB;--cc-blue-hover: #0B48A8;--cc-blue-light: #EAF0FB;--cc-dark: #111111;--cc-text: #555555;--cc-text-muted: #888888;--cc-border: #d5dce8;--cc-border-focus: #0D53BB;--cc-bg-page: #f0f3f8;--cc-bg-card: #ffffff;--cc-bg-input: #ffffff;--cc-bg-field: #f7f9fc;--cc-error: #dc2626;--cc-error-bg: #fef2f2;--cc-shadow: 0 2px 12px rgba(0, 0, 0, .07);--cc-shadow-card: 0 4px 24px rgba(0, 0, 0, .09);--cc-radius: 10px;--cc-radius-sm: 6px;--cc-transition: .18s ease;--cc-font: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, sans-serif}.cc-import-calculator,.cc-import-calculator *,.cc-import-calculator *:before,.cc-import-calculator *:after{box-sizing:border-box}.cc-import-calculator{font-family:var(--cc-font);font-size:16px;color:var(--cc-text);background:var(--cc-bg-page);padding:40px 16px 60px;min-height:60vh}.cc-import-calculator__container{max-width:720px;margin:0 auto}.cc-import-calculator__header{text-align:center;margin-bottom:28px}.cc-import-calculator__title{font-size:24px;font-weight:700;color:var(--cc-dark);margin:0 0 8px;line-height:1.3;letter-spacing:-.01em}.cc-import-calculator__subtitle{font-size:14px;color:var(--cc-text-muted);margin:0;line-height:1.5}.cc-import-calculator__card{background:var(--cc-bg-card);border-radius:var(--cc-radius);box-shadow:var(--cc-shadow-card);padding:32px 36px;margin-bottom:24px}.cc-form__group{margin-bottom:0;padding-bottom:24px}.cc-form__group:not(:last-child){border-bottom:1px solid #edf0f5;margin-bottom:24px}.cc-form__group--collapsible{overflow:hidden;transition:opacity var(--cc-transition)}.cc-form__group--collapsible[hidden]{display:none}.cc-form__group--error .cc-form__input,.cc-form__group--error .cc-form__select{border-color:var(--cc-error);background:var(--cc-error-bg)}.cc-form__label{display:block;font-size:13px;font-weight:600;color:var(--cc-text-muted);margin-bottom:8px;letter-spacing:.06em;text-transform:uppercase}.cc-form__currency{font-weight:400;color:var(--cc-text-muted);font-size:13px;text-transform:none;letter-spacing:0}.cc-form__input{display:block;width:100%;padding:11px 14px;font-size:16px;font-family:var(--cc-font);color:var(--cc-text);background:var(--cc-bg-input);border:1.5px solid var(--cc-border);border-radius:var(--cc-radius-sm);outline:none;transition:border-color var(--cc-transition),box-shadow var(--cc-transition);-moz-appearance:textfield}.cc-form__input::-webkit-outer-spin-button,.cc-form__input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.cc-form__input::placeholder{color:#aab0ba}.cc-form__input:focus{border-color:var(--cc-border-focus);box-shadow:0 0 0 3px #0d53bb1f}.cc-form__select{display:block;width:100%;padding:11px 40px 11px 14px;font-size:16px;font-family:var(--cc-font);color:var(--cc-text);background-color:var(--cc-bg-input);background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='16' height='16' viewBox='0 0 24 24' fill='none' stroke='%236b7280'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='6 9 12 15 18 9'%3E%3C/polyline%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 14px center;border:1.5px solid var(--cc-border);border-radius:var(--cc-radius-sm);out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;cursor:pointer;transition:border-color var(--cc-transition),box-shadow var(--cc-transition)}.cc-form__select:focus{border-color:var(--cc-border-focus);box-shadow:0 0 0 3px #0d53bb1f}.cc-form__select:invalid,.cc-form__select option[value=""]{color:#aab0ba}.cc-form__hint{margin:6px 0 0;font-size:13px;color:var(--cc-text-muted);line-height:1.5}.cc-form__error{margin:6px 0 0;font-size:13px;color:var(--cc-error);font-weight:500}.cc-form__error[hidden]{display:none}.cc-pill-group{display:flex;gap:8px;flex-wrap:wrap;background:var(--cc-bg-field);padding:10px 12px;border-radius:var(--cc-radius-sm);border:1px solid var(--cc-border)}.cc-pill{position:relative;cursor:pointer;-webkit-user-select:none;user-select:none}.cc-pill input[type=radio]{position:absolute;opacity:0;width:0;height:0;margin:0}.cc-pill span{display:inline-flex;align-items:center;padding:7px 18px;font-size:14px;font-weight:600;border:1.5px solid var(--cc-border);border-radius:100px;background:var(--cc-bg-card);color:var(--cc-text);transition:border-color var(--cc-transition),background var(--cc-transition),color var(--cc-transition);white-space:nowrap}.cc-pill input[type=radio]:checked+span{background:var(--cc-blue);border-color:var(--cc-blue);color:#fff}.cc-pill:hover span{border-color:var(--cc-blue)}.cc-pill input[type=radio]:focus-visible+span{outline:2px solid var(--cc-blue);outline-offset:2px}.cc-option-list{display:flex;flex-direction:column;gap:8px}.cc-option{display:flex;align-items:flex-start;gap:12px;padding:13px 16px;border:1.5px solid var(--cc-border);border-radius:var(--cc-radius-sm);cursor:pointer;background:var(--cc-bg-card);transition:border-color var(--cc-transition),background var(--cc-transition);position:relative;-webkit-user-select:none;user-select:none}.cc-option input[type=radio]{position:absolute;opacity:0;width:0;height:0}.cc-option:before{content:"";flex-shrink:0;width:18px;height:18px;border:2px solid var(--cc-border);border-radius:50%;margin-top:2px;margin-right:4px;background:#fff;transition:border-color var(--cc-transition)}.cc-option:has(input:checked):before{border-color:var(--cc-blue);background:radial-gradient(circle,var(--cc-blue) 45%,transparent 46%)}.cc-option:has(input:checked){border-color:var(--cc-blue);background:var(--cc-blue-light)}.cc-option:hover{border-color:var(--cc-blue)}.cc-option input[type=radio]:focus-visible~.cc-option__body{outline:2px solid var(--cc-blue);outline-offset:2px;border-radius:2px}.cc-option__body{display:flex;flex-direction:column;gap:2px}.cc-option__title{font-size:14px;font-weight:600;color:var(--cc-dark)}.cc-option__desc{font-size:13px;color:var(--cc-text-muted);line-height:1.45}.cc-form__actions{margin-top:28px;padding-top:20px;border-top:1px solid #edf0f5}.cc-btn{display:inline-flex;align-items:center;justify-content:center;padding:13px 28px;font-size:15px;font-family:var(--cc-font);font-weight:600;border:none;border-radius:var(--cc-radius-sm);cursor:pointer;text-decoration:none;transition:background var(--cc-transition),transform var(--cc-transition),box-shadow var(--cc-transition);letter-spacing:.02em}.cc-btn--primary{width:100%;background:var(--cc-blue);color:#fff;box-shadow:0 2px 8px #0d53bb40}.cc-btn--primary:hover{background:var(--cc-blue-hover);box-shadow:0 4px 16px #0d53bb4d;transform:translateY(-1px)}.cc-btn--primary:active{transform:translateY(0);box-shadow:none}.cc-result[hidden]{display:none}.cc-result{animation:cc-fade-in .3s ease}@keyframes cc-fade-in{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}.cc-result__card{background:var(--cc-bg-card);border-radius:var(--cc-radius);box-shadow:var(--cc-shadow-card);padding:32px 36px}.cc-result__title{font-size:17px;font-weight:700;color:var(--cc-dark);margin:0 0 20px;padding-bottom:14px;border-bottom:2px solid #edf0f5}.cc-breakdown{display:flex;flex-direction:column}.cc-breakdown__row{display:flex;justify-content:space-between;align-items:baseline;gap:16px;padding:8px 0}.cc-breakdown__label{font-size:14px;color:var(--cc-text);flex:1}.cc-breakdown__amount{font-size:14px;font-weight:500;color:var(--cc-dark);white-space:nowrap;font-variant-numeric:tabular-nums}.cc-breakdown__note{font-size:13px;color:var(--cc-text-muted);font-style:italic;white-space:nowrap}.cc-breakdown__row--subtotal .cc-breakdown__label,.cc-breakdown__row--subtotal .cc-breakdown__amount{font-weight:600;color:var(--cc-dark)}.cc-breakdown__row--total{margin-top:4px;padding:14px 16px;background:var(--cc-blue-light);border-radius:var(--cc-radius-sm);border:1.5px solid var(--cc-blue)}.cc-breakdown__row--total .cc-breakdown__label{font-size:16px;font-weight:700;color:var(--cc-dark)}.cc-breakdown__row--total .cc-breakdown__amount{font-size:18px;font-weight:700;color:var(--cc-blue)}.cc-breakdown__separator{height:1px;background:#edf0f5;margin:4px 0}.cc-result__config-error{padding:16px;background:var(--cc-error-bg);border:1px solid var(--cc-error);border-radius:var(--cc-radius-sm);color:var(--cc-error);font-size:14px;margin:0}.cc-result__disclaimer{margin:18px 0 0;padding-top:14px;border-top:1px solid #edf0f5;font-size:12px;color:var(--cc-text-muted);line-height:1.6}.cc-result__contact-link{color:var(--cc-blue);text-decoration:underline}.cc-result__contact-link:hover{color:var(--cc-blue-hover)}@media(max-width:600px){.cc-import-calculator{padding:24px 12px 44px}.cc-import-calculator__title{font-size:19px}.cc-import-calculator__subtitle{font-size:14px}.cc-import-calculator__card,.cc-result__card{padding:22px 18px}.cc-pill span{padding:6px 14px;font-size:13px}.cc-pill-group{padding:8px 10px}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/import-calculator.css.map */
